October 3, 2017

Washington, D.C. – Today, Representative Raul Ruiz, M.D. (CA-36) wrote to California Governor Brown urging him to sign Senate Bill 5, which includes $200 million in funding for mitigation and restoration efforts at the Salton Sea. The bond proposal is critical to addressing the long-term public health and environmental impacts of the decline of the Sea on Riverside and Imperial counties.

August 15, 2017

Palm Desert, CA – Today, Representative Raul Ruiz, M.D. (CA-36), a member of the Energy and Commerce Committee, responded to the non-partisan Congressional Budget Office analysis, which found that if the Trump administration refuses to fund Cost Sharing Reductions (CSR) subsidies that help patients pay for co-pays and deductibles, premiums in silver plans would rise by 25 percent by 2020 and market instability would increase.
